Super Bowl XLVI: 20 pregame facts
Loading...
Before settling into your favorite recliner or couch for Sunday鈥檚 big game, here鈥檚 a quick collection of information to help you enjoy America鈥檚 most watched sports event:
1 - Kickoff on NBC is at 6:30 p.m., ET.
2 - Tickets were still being sold on the NFL鈥檚 website this week for between $2,609 and $15,343.
3 - This game is the sixth rematch of previous Super Bowl opponents.聽 The other rematches paired the Dallas Cowboys and Pittsburgh Steelers (twice), the Cowboys and Buffalo Bills (in the only back-to-back rematch), the Washington Redskins and Miami Dolphins, and San Francisco 49ers and Cincinnati Bengals.
4 - Both the Giants and the Patriots are seeking to win their fourth Super Bowls. Pittsburgh owns the record with six SB titles.
5 - The 30-minute Super Bowl halftime is twice as long as that for other games due to the logistics of a musical extravaganza, which this year stars Madonna.
6 - The two Super Bowl coaches, New York鈥檚 Tom Coughlin and New England鈥檚 Bill Belichick, were assistants to Bill Parcells when the Giants won Super Bowls XXI and XXV.
7 - If New England wins, Belichick will join Pittsburgh鈥檚 Chuck Noll as the only coach to lead four Super Bowl winners. If New York wins, Coughlin, at 65, will become the game鈥檚 oldest winning coach.聽
8 - The 鈥淢HK鈥 on the Patriot jerseys is in honor of Myra H. Kraft, the wife of team owner Bob Kraft. Mrs. Kraft passed away in July.
9 - Giants linebacker Mathias Kiwanuku is returning to Indianapolis, his hometown, where he starred in high school. The Boston College grad is the grandson of the first elected prime minister of Uganda, Benedictor Kiwanuka, who was assassinated by Idi Amin鈥檚 henchmen in 1972.
10 - New England鈥檚 Tom Brady was this season鈥檚 third-rated NFL quarterback based on a statistical formula. He finished behind Aaron Rodgers and Drew Brees. New York鈥檚 Eli Manning was seventh-rated.
11 - When Manning takes the field Sunday, he will be the only Manning to play in Indianapolis this season. Older brother Peyton of the Indianapolis Colts sat out the entire season while recovering from neck surgery. Peyton and Eli Manning were back-to-back Super Bowl MVPs in 2006 and 2007.
12 - If New York wins, it will become the first team with a 9-7 regular season record to wind up as Super Bowl champions.
13 - Sunday鈥檚 game is the first Super Bowl hosted by Indianapolis. It marks the fourth time the Super Bowl has been played in a northern city in a domed stadium, in this case Lucas Oil Stadium. Pontiac, Mich.; Minneapolis; and Detroit are the other northern SB sites.
14 - When the Giants and Patriots met four years ago in Super Bowl XLII, the Giants spoiled New England鈥檚 bid to become the first 19-0 team in league history.
15 - An unusually high number of undrafted free agents populate both Super Bowl rosters. Eighteen play for the Patriots, 11 for the Giants, The Boston Globe reports.
16 - Patriots wide receiver Wes Welker easily led the league in pass receptions this season, with 122. The next most was 100, by Atlanta鈥檚 Roddy White.
17 - The Patriots鈥 pass defense ranked 31st out of 32 NFL teams during the regular season. The Giants were little better, at 29th.
18 - The two teams met in Week 9 of the regular season, when the Giants won, 24-20.
19 - The Giants had to defeat defending Super Bowl champion Green Bay and this year鈥檚 surprise contender, San Francisco, on the road in the playoffs to advance to Super Sunday.
20 - The Giants suffered four straight losses during the second half of the season before getting hot.聽
